Job

Overview

The Head of Platform Management, U.S. Institutional, is a commercially focused operator responsible for translating strategy into execution. In partnership with the Head of U.S. Institutional and other enterprise leaders, this role will prioritize the design and implementation of mission‑critical processes that drive new client acquisition and deepen relationships with existing clients. Working in partnership with client‑facing teams across the U.S. Institutional group, the Head of Platform Management will ensure disciplined coordination of internal and external efforts at each stage of the client lifecycle, from prospect engagement through due diligence and onboarding.

The role will also own the orchestration of strategic engagements with clients and prospects, including communication plans and proactive executive outreach.

We’ll Trust You To
  • Design and drive processes to acquire new clients and grow with existing clients.
  • Partner with the Head of U.S. Institutional and client‑facing teams to build standard operating procedures that accelerate acquisition of new institutional clients and expand relationships with existing clients.
  • Ensure disciplined implementation of processes that enhance the firm’s ability to execute at critical points in the client acquisition process, e.g., transitioning engaged prospects into formal due diligence.
  • Coordinate and advise cross‑functional working groups and deal teams to optimize engagements with clients and prospects, e.g., due diligence on‑sites, finals presentations, and industry conferences.
  • Provide actionable analysis and insights.
  • Monitor and analyze Institutional Sales, Client Relationship Management, and Consultant Relations data and dashboards to assess progress against stated goals, i.e., increasing the number of engaged prospects moving into due diligence, the conversion rate for prospects in due diligence, and the number of existing clients doing follow‑on allocations or awarding new mandates.
  • Collaborate with institutional teams to acquire and deliver intelligence/data that informs prospecting and due diligence efforts, including development of prospect and client profiles.
  • Prepare and deliver executive‑level reporting that provides insights into the health of the platform, informs strategy, and optimizes resource allocation.
  • Own day‑to‑day platform management.
  • Establish and manage the operating cadence of the U.S. Institutional platform, including engagements and deliverables that promote transparency and information flow, i.e., team‑wide strategy briefings and reporting, client lifecycle analyses, etc.
  • Act as the primary coordination point for internal teams across Investments, Client Services (Marketing/Product Management, Client Information Services, RFP Team), and Corporate Services (Finance, Legal, Compliance, Operations, Technology, Finance).
  • Partner with Finance and Human Capital Management on budgeting, expense management, headcount planning, and financial analysis.
